Red Sichuan Peppercorns

Red Sichuan pepper, also known as Szechuan pepper or Chinese prickly ash, is a spice commonly used in Chinese cuisine, particularly in the Sichuan region. Despite its name, it is not a true pepper but rather the dried outer husks of the seeds from the Zanthoxylum genus of plants, primarily Zanthoxylum simulans or Zanthoxylum bungeanum.

Red Sichuan peppercorns, also known as Szechuan peppercorns, are a type of spice derived from the dried berries of the Zanthoxylum genus, particularly Zanthoxylum bungeanum. These peppercorns are a key ingredient in Chinese and other Asian cuisines, particularly in the Sichuan province. The "red" in the name refers to the color of the dried berries.

Here are some key characteristics of Red Sichuan peppercorns:

  1. Color: The berries are typically reddish-brown in color, distinguishing them from other varieties of Sichuan peppercorns, which may be green or brown.

  2. Flavor Profile: Red Sichuan peppercorns have a unique flavor profile that includes citrusy, peppery, and floral notes. They also impart a tingling or numbing sensation on the tongue, which is characteristic of Sichuan peppercorns.

  3. Use in Cooking: Like other varieties of Sichuan peppercorns, the red variety is used in a variety of dishes in Sichuan cuisine, such as Mapo Tofu, Kung Pao Chicken, and Sichuan hot pot. They are often toasted and ground before being added to dishes to enhance their flavor.

  4. Toasting and Grinding: Toasting Red Sichuan peppercorns in a dry pan before use can enhance their aroma. They are often ground before being incorporated into recipes to release their flavors more effectively.

  5. Appearance: The dried berries are small and have a wrinkled appearance. The red color can vary, and it may deepen or lighten depending on factors such as the ripeness of the berries and the drying process.

Red Sichuan peppercorns, like other varieties of Sichuan peppercorns, are known for their ability to add depth and complexity to dishes, along with their unique numbing effect. They are a key element in the bold and flavorful cuisine of the Sichuan province in China.

Characteristics of red Sichuan pepper include:

  1. Flavor Profile:

    Red Sichuan pepper imparts a unique and complex flavor to dishes. It is known for its citrusy and floral notes, combined with a tingling, numbing sensation on the tongue. This distinctive numbing quality is a hallmark of Sichuan cuisine.

  2. Color and Appearance:

    As the name suggests, the outer husks of the seeds are reddish-brown, contributing a warm and vibrant hue to dishes. The seeds themselves are often discarded, and only the husks are used in cooking.

  3. Heat Level:

    While it adds a subtle heat to dishes, the primary characteristic of red Sichuan pepper is the numbing sensation it imparts due to the presence of hydroxy-alpha-sanshool, a compound found in the husks.

  4. Culinary Uses:

    Red Sichuan pepper is a key ingredient in Sichuan cuisine and is used in various dishes, including hot pots, stir-fries, and sauces. It pairs well with other spices and ingredients to create the signature "ma la" (numbing and spicy) flavor for which Sichuan cuisine is renowned.

  5. Health Benefits:

    In addition to its culinary uses, Sichuan pepper is believed to have potential health benefits. It is thought to aid digestion, stimulate appetite, and have anti-inflammatory properties.

  6. Cultural Significance:

    Red Sichuan pepper plays a significant role in the culinary traditions of Sichuan province in China. It is one of the key ingredients in the famous Chinese Five Spice Powder and is widely used in both traditional and modern Chinese cooking.

It's important to note that there is also a green variety of Sichuan pepper, which is harvested before full maturity and has a slightly different flavor profile compared to the red variety. Both green and red Sichuan peppers contribute to the diverse and rich tapestry of flavors in Chinese cuisine.

Wholesale Red Sichuan Pepper -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

  1. Q1: What is Red Sichuan Pepper?

  2. A1: Red Sichuan Pepper, also known as Szechuan or Sichuan peppercorns, is a spice derived from the dried berries of the Zanthoxylum genus. It is widely used in Chinese and other Asian cuisines and is known for its unique citrusy, peppery flavor, and a tingling or numbing sensation.

  3. Q2: How are Red Sichuan Peppercorns used in cooking?

  4. A2: Red Sichuan Peppercorns are often toasted and ground before being added to dishes to enhance their aroma and release their flavors. They are a key ingredient in Sichuan cuisine, used in various dishes such as Mapo Tofu, Kung Pao Chicken, and hot pot.
